Transaction 2eeff932106a48cfcce0456f69508ee93ed87fca1cbba255c27c9b6d3aa81444

2 Input
1 Outputs
  • 2eeff932106a48cfcce0456f69508ee93ed87fca1cbba255c27c9b6d3aa81444:0
  • value  2193266
    address  1HDgeedP81392u2xCZH6UYffUYKnffjVkZ